This wonderful vintage Native-made belt buckle is a charming early Southwestern piece with a clean rectangular form and beautifully balanced silverwork. The buckle features a center opening with rounded ends, framed on each long side by three individually bezel set turquoise cabochons in a lovely bluish-green hue. Decorative stampwork adds character throughout the design, including outward-pointing arrows in each corner that give the piece a classic vintage feel. The back is stamped SOLID SILVER HAND MADE BY INDIANS, a period mark often seen on older Native-made silver pieces. Designed to accommodate belts up to 1.125 inches wide, this buckle is a distinctive and collectible accessory with wonderful historic appeal.
Condition Note: this piece came to me without any hardware. I brought it to a store in Old Town Scottsdale which specializes in Native American jewelry and employs two Navajo silversmiths to perform repairs. One of them determined that this piece was originally a belt buckle and added the appropriate hardware.
